The British fintech giant Revolut has successfully wrapped up a substantial secondary share offering, reinforcing its position as a leading digital finance platform globally. Announced on Monday, this latest funding round elevates the company’s valuation to an impressive $75 billion, signaling growing investor trust in its range of advanced banking, trading, and financial services.
The share offering attracted a diverse array of prominent investors, including Coatue, Greenoaks, and venture capital firm Andreessen Horowitz, along with Nvidia's venture capital division, among various institutional supporters. This varied investment base illustrates the market's acknowledgment of Revolut's strong growth potential and its expanding market presence in crucial areas such as Europe, the U.S., and Asia.
Since its inception, Revolut has continuously broadened its range of services, transitioning from a digital payment solution into a full-fledged financial ecosystem. Customers can now access an array of services including currency exchanges, stock and commodity trading, cryptocurrency dealings, savings, insurance, and financial planning tools. This shift has positioned Revolut as the preferred choice for tech-savvy individuals seeking seamless digital banking solutions.
Market analysts believe that this secondary share sale indicates a rekindled interest among investors in fintech opportunities, especially those showing resilience in fluctuating markets. The substantial valuation places Revolut among the top-tier fintech enterprises, highlighting its ability to attract institutional investments keen on supporting rapidly growing digital banking entities.
Moving forward, Revolut intends to utilize the raised funds to hasten product development, scale operations, and fortify its technological framework. This strategic initiative aims to improve user experience, expand service offerings, and propel its goal to penetrate new international markets, keeping up with the swiftly evolving global fintech scene.
With this achievement, Revolut not only secures its status among the leading fintech players worldwide but also sets a precedent for valuation standards and investor confidence within the digital banking sector.
